      Where does demotivate come from?

      The word demotivate breaks down into 4 roots of Latin origin: de-, from Latin de (“reversal, removal”); mot, from Latin movere (“to move”); -iv, from Latin -ivus (“tending to”); and -ate, from Latin -atus (“to make, do”).
